Background technology
In order to mitigate product weight, reduction production cost, often with thin-wall steel tube two-port rolling assembling short axle in production
Substitute steel bar.The thin-wall steel tube port rolling assembling short axle production of small lot, generally pincers worker manual operations, the labor of workman
Fatigue resistance is larger, and production efficiency is relatively low, unstable product quality after assembling.Technical demand one kind substitutes manual rolling
Device.

In this preferred embodiment, a diameter of Φ 30mm of thin-wall steel tube 20 of rolling are assembled, wall thickness is δ 1.8mm, and short axle 21 is straight
Footpath is Φ 26.4.
Thin-wall steel tube 20 is clamped with lathe three-claw chuck, the short axle 21 matched with thin-wall steel tube is put into, makes thin-wall steel tube 20
Slow rotation, while rotating threaded shaft 2, drives left slider 4, right sliding block 10 to be moved in locating channel, make left slider 4, right sliding block
10 are moved with pressure roller 8 to the working face of thin-wall steel tube 20, and three pressure rollers 8 are rolled to the working face of thin-wall steel tube 20 simultaneously
Pressure, is rolled the working face of thin-wall steel tube 20 and extended to the empty place of short axle 21, finally roll thin-wall steel tube 20 with short axle 21
Consolidation, completes assembling rolling work.
